The Braille Institute San Diego invites students and the community to participate in a special White Cane Awareness Day Walk in our Courtyard. Attendees will learn and explore white cane safety, low-sight navigation, and fall prevention tips. The program includes resource tables, live music, and community partners. Community partners in attendance include the National Federation of the Blind (NFB), San Diego Center for the Blind, Guide Dogs for the Blind, and GiftedBack. Braille Institute is a nonprofit providing free programs and services to people with vision loss since 1919. Our programs reach more than 25,000 visually impaired people across seven centers. The San Diego Center is a low-vision hub for people seeking independence skills and life-changing resources.   • En colaboración con la Oficina del Sheriff del Condado de San Diego y Alzheimer’s San Diego, se va a estar proveyendo un programa de registro y educación sobre Llévame a Casa. Este programa provee consejos prácticos para manejar el comportamiento relacionados con la deambulación de las personas que viven con demencia. Aprenda más sobre las razones por las que las personas con demencia deambulan y las formas de reducir el riesgo. El Departamento del Sheriff explicará cómo funciona el programa Llévame a Casa y compartirá historias de éxito. Esta clase virtual es presentada por la organización local Alzheimer's San Diego.
